Output 3f23143bf60f535d736dfb2553bd0b2c9c3afee615059734501e1eeaa56c4411:1

value
735379494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c047db7eb82f4b52fa828b8e0c3719ca0c4129c OP_EQUAL
address
3ETMuSqSvRzzBPBJsJURQLX7DwQCCXBZdw
transaction
3f23143bf60f535d736dfb2553bd0b2c9c3afee615059734501e1eeaa56c4411
spent
true